CP Rail was a partner along with a large shipping agent in the Brunterm container terminal here in Saint John from the mid 70's to its exit in 95. They have NO interest in container traffic east of Montreal

I honestly don't know why everyone in Maine is praying for this terminal,look at all the large terminals around the northeast they all are in a downturn (Halifax,Montreal,Boston,New York,Saint John) you want to spent hundreds of millions of dollars to build a terminal to let it sit and rot away?

The ships of today are getting larger and larger and require massive terminals to support them,look at Halifax they need to invest in a new terminal just to keep up with the shipping lines of today.

If you think for one second any shipping line will leave Halifax or Boston or even Montreal to dock at Mack Point your smoking way too much of that special tobacco :wink: they already have the terminals and equipment and are the terminals of choice of shipping lines.

The container market is already over saturated and many smaller terminals are slowly dieing off and for a good example look at Saint John...2 cranes,new dockside support equipment and a warf in excellant condition and we see one ship a week

Mack Point is a pipe dream in a world market of container shipping and a market slowing killing off terminals one by one world wide.

Valid points. The container terminal in Portland has been dormant for the past couple of years. The government (can't remember if it was city, state, federal, or a combination of all three) spent a ton of money on a new crane and assorted other improvements, but now it's a mini ghost town.
